China Zhejiang Hangzhou Alibaba Cloud
Websites on 121.196.202.56
- Domain names that have been bound:
- 2019-03-08-----2020-04-02snsmad.com
- 2019-08-24-----2019-08-24www.snsmad.com
- 2017-03-30-----2017-03-30e188.net
- website server lookup history
- www.01398.com
- djdl777.com
- www.18sex.com
- data.jpg4.net
- en.ipip.net
- 178c21.com
- myanmarxxx.com
- www.xzfefangen.com
- bc6028.com
- xxxx12.com
- japan060207.ippa.com
- m.biquge6.com
- m.tat8866.com
- www.520238.com
- cao6.vip
- zdyx33.com
- qqb4.com
- malie.net
- www.722927.com
- xgllhxtzt.com
- hosting ip address lookup history
- 103.97.1.173
- 38.163.59.21
- 67.229.72.126
- 185.227.153.9
- 180.153.69.153
- 192.249.91.236
- 168.76.115.34
- 27.111.83.67
- 184.31.228.82
- 154.89.164.114
- 156.230.195.181
- 223.153.100.74
- 172.233.219.78
- 154.81.231.9
- 149.29.104.88
- 222.76.118.4
- 100.64.132.149
- 93.90.145.100
- 38.165.126.45
- 154.210.53.11
